When a tag for an anime might spoil contents further along in the series (but also be important enough to warrant being tagged in the first place), then you might not want to proudly display it for someone who randomly stumbles upon the anime. So instead, an anime might mark one of it's tags as a spoiler which would not impact searches or recommendations in any way, but would simply just make the tag hidden until you hover the cursor over it or something.

A good example of this could be https://www.anime-planet.com/anime/puella-magi-madoka-magica which tries to keep up it's façade up until episode 3 considering it is one of those shows your best to go in blind with.
A spoiler tag might indicate to a potential viewer not to judge the show by it's cover and to let it tell it's story before making that final judgement on whether to watch the show.

Moving this to completed not because we won't do it, but because it's already being tracked/is likely a long ways down the road. tl;dr: yes, we plan to have spoiler tag functionality eventually and it's being tracked internally.

We've always wanted to add spoiler tags, but it's a large problem that will take a large amount of work to fix and design. Not only the UI like it's suggested above (or some similar format), but also it means we'll need to completely redo our search functionality (for example, searching for [x tag that's a spoiler in some case] and seeing the anime show up in results is a spoiler), adding preferences for users (show results for spoiler series in search results/on anime pages/etc), and more.

Note, though, that we wouldn't use them for cases like Madoka. 3 eps is early enough that for our tagging purposes, we don't consider it a spoiler. But we would be able to finally add tags like tragedy (pretty much always a spoiler), yandere, or other tags that happen much later on.
